- The distance between Sao Luis, Brazil and Innsbruck, Austria is approximately 7,729 km or 4,803 mi.
- To reach Sao Luis in this distance one would set out from Innsbruck bearing 241.7°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Sao Luis bearing 216.7° or SW .
- Sao Luis has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am) whereas Innsbruck has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Sao Luis is in or near the tropical moist forest biome whereas Innsbruck is in or near the boreal rain for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 17.6 °C (31.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 19.7 °C (35.5°F) less in Sao Luis.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1457.1 mm (57.4 in) more which is equivalent to 1457.1 l/m² (35.76 US gal/ft²) or 14,571,000 l/ha (1,557,737 US gal/ac) more. About 2 2/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 31.7° higher in Sao Luis than in Innsbruck.
- Relative humidity levels are 13.2%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 19.7°C (35.4°F) higher.
